use crate::primitives::{CustomTransaction, TxPayment}; use alloy_consensus::{ crypto::RecoveryError, error::ValueError, transaction::{SignerRecoverable, TxHashRef}, Signed, TransactionEnvelope, }; use alloy_primitives::{Address, Sealed, B256}; use op_alloy_consensus::{OpPooledTransaction, OpTransaction, TxDeposit}; use reth_ethereum::primitives::{ serde_bincode_compat::RlpBincode, InMemorySize, SignedTransaction, }; #[derive(Clone, Debug, TransactionEnvelope)] #[envelope(tx_type_name = CustomPooledTxType)] pub enum CustomPooledTransaction { /// A regular Optimism transaction as defined by [`OpPooledTransaction`]. #[envelope(flatten)] Op(OpPooledTransaction), /// A [`TxPayment`] tagged with type 0x2A (decimal 42). #[envelope(ty = 42)] Payment(Signed), } impl From for CustomTransaction { fn from(tx: CustomPooledTransaction) -> Self { match tx { CustomPooledTransaction::Op(tx) => Self::Op(tx.into()), CustomPooledTransaction::Payment(tx) => Self::Payment(tx), } } } impl TryFrom for CustomPooledTransaction { type Error = ValueError; fn try_from(tx: CustomTransaction) -> Result { match tx { CustomTransaction::Op(op) => Ok(Self::Op( OpPooledTransaction::try_from(op).map_err(|op| op.map(CustomTransaction::Op))?, )), CustomTransaction::Payment(payment) => Ok(Self::Payment(payment)), } } } impl RlpBincode for CustomPooledTransaction {} impl OpTransaction for CustomPooledTransaction { fn is_deposit(&self) -> bool { false } fn as_deposit(&self) -> Option<&Sealed> { None } } impl SignerRecoverable for CustomPooledTransaction { fn recover_signer(&self) -> Result { match self { CustomPooledTransaction::Op(tx) => SignerRecoverable::recover_signer(tx), CustomPooledTransaction::Payment(tx) => SignerRecoverable::recover_signer(tx), } } fn recover_signer_unchecked(&self) -> Result { match self { CustomPooledTransaction::Op(tx) => SignerRecoverable::recover_signer_unchecked(tx), CustomPooledTransaction::Payment(tx) => SignerRecoverable::recover_signer_unchecked(tx), } } } impl TxHashRef for CustomPooledTransaction { fn tx_hash(&self) -> &B256 { match self { CustomPooledTransaction::Op(tx) => tx.tx_hash(), CustomPooledTransaction::Payment(tx) => tx.hash(), } } } impl SignedTransaction for CustomPooledTransaction {} impl InMemorySize for CustomPooledTransaction { fn size(&self) -> usize { match self { CustomPooledTransaction::Op(tx) => InMemorySize::size(tx), CustomPooledTransaction::Payment(tx) => InMemorySize::size(tx), } } }
